University of California, Los Angeles — OIG Enforcement (2026)

OIG took enforcement action against University of California, Los Angeles in CA in 2026 involving excluded individual violations in the K-12 School Districts sector.

Penalty: $470,000

Violation types: Excluded Individual
Entity type: Healthcare Provider
Penalty type: Fine
Location: CA

Source: University of California, Los Angeles Agreed to Pay $470,000 for Allegedly Violating the Civil Monetary Penalties Law by Employing an Excluded Individual
